“…The physics, chemistry and biology of this region is well characterized (Karl and Lukas, 1996;White et al, 2007), and its microbial metagenome is well represented in the nt sequence databases (DeLong et al, 2006;Frias-Lopez et al, 2008;Hewson et al, 2010). In the North Pacific, where N 2 fixation is a major supply of nitrogen (Karl et al, 1997), phosphorus and iron can be the limiting nutrients for N 2 fixation and primary production (Karl et al, 2001;Moore et al, 2006;Grabowski et al, 2008;Karl and Letelier, 2008;Watkins-Brandt et al, 2011). We hypothesized that if microbial taxa were Fe limited, Fe addition would result in decreased transcription of ironstress genes and increased transcription of genes for energy, carbon and nitrogen metabolism.…”
